We are a leading owner and operator of short line and regional freight railroads in the United States, Australia and Canada and own a minority interest in a railroad in Bolivia. In addition, we provide freight car switching and rail-related services to industrial companies in the United States and Australia. The Company’s corporate predecessor was founded in 1899 as a 14-mile rail line serving a single salt mine in upstate New York and since 1977, we have completed 30 acquisitions.

By focusing our corporate and regional management teams on improving our return on invested capital, we intend to continue to increase our earnings and cash flow. In addition, we expect that acquisitions will adhere to our return on capital targets and that existing operations will strive to improve year-over-year financial returns and safety performance.
